Abstract:
The invention relates to method and apparatus for transmitting an optical signal having optical energy substantially in a high order spatial mode. The optical waveguide, in one embodiment, includes a few mode fiber designed to have specific transmission characteristics for supporting the single high order spatial mode, and the few mode fiber transmits the single high order spatial mode. The optical waveguide, in one embodiment, has a dispersion and a dispersion slope for a given transmission bandwidth. Another aspect of the invention includes a method for transmitting an optical signal having optical energy substantially in a single high order spatial mode. The method includes the steps of providing a few mode fiber, which supports optical energy in the single high order spatial mode. In one embodiment, the single high order spatial mode is the LP02 spatial mode. In another embodiment, the few mode fiber supports an optical signal having optical energy having less than twenty spatial modes.
